diff --git a/src/ulock/dlock/lib/common/jetty_mgr_sepconn.cpp b/src/ulock/dlock/lib/common/jetty_mgr_sepconn.cpp index 44e8f7675d0185e8ddbcf253c45f34fcc37bc453..05470023de3b49982191f8f3d6c05434de32fedf 100644 --- a/src/ulock/dlock/lib/common/jetty_mgr_sepconn.cpp +++ b/src/ulock/dlock/lib/common/jetty_mgr_sepconn.cpp @@ -406,10 +406,10 @@ dlock_status_t jetty_mgr_sepconn::post_cas(uint32_t offset, uint64_t cmp_data, u #ifdef UB_AGG dlock_status_t jetty_mgr_sepconn::get_urma_bond_id_info(urma_bond_id_info_out_t *bond_id_info) const { - urma_bond_id_info_in_t in = { - .jfr = m_jfr, - .type = URMA_JFR, - }; + urma_bond_id_info_in_t in = {0}; + in.jfr = m_jfr; + in.type = URMA_JFR; + urma_user_ctl_in_t user_ctl_in = { .addr = (uint64_t)&in, .len = sizeof(urma_bond_id_info_in_t), diff --git a/src/ulock/dlock/lib/common/jetty_mgr_uniconn.cpp b/src/ulock/dlock/lib/common/jetty_mgr_uniconn.cpp index 7be1fecdee320c16ad574c143060f0c791063c3a..52a94ae064da35d231f5d8fd198bbb7cc4149f4c 100644 --- a/src/ulock/dlock/lib/common/jetty_mgr_uniconn.cpp +++ b/src/ulock/dlock/lib/common/jetty_mgr_uniconn.cpp @@ -534,10 +534,10 @@ dlock_status_t jetty_mgr_uniconn::post_cas(uint32_t offset, uint64_t cmp_data, u #ifdef UB_AGG dlock_status_t jetty_mgr_uniconn::get_urma_bond_id_info(urma_bond_id_info_out_t *bond_id_info) const { - urma_bond_id_info_in_t in = { - .jetty = m_jetty, - .type = URMA_JETTY, - }; + urma_bond_id_info_in_t in = {0}; + in.jetty = m_jetty; + in.type = URMA_JETTY; + urma_user_ctl_in_t user_ctl_in = { .addr = (uint64_t)&in, .len = sizeof(urma_bond_id_info_in_t),